Property Description

This three-bedroom, detached property comes to the market in Ely Close, Darlington. For sale with no onward chain this is a fantastic opportunity for buyers.

Upon entering, the welcoming hallway leads through to a bright and generously proportioned open-plan lounge and dining area, featuring large windows that flood the space with natural light. The fitted kitchen offers a good range of wall and base units, with a useful adjoining utility room providing access to both the garage and rear garden.

Upstairs, the property benefits from three bedrooms. The spacious principal bedroom features fitted wardrobes, while the second bedroom also benefits from fitted storage and enjoys lovely views across the fields to the rear. The third bedroom is a smaller room with a bespoke, custom-made bed, making excellent use of the available space.

The accommodation is completed by a family bathroom and a separate WC.

Externally, the property benefits from a private driveway providing off-road parking, an integral garage, and a particularly attractive south-east facing rear garden. The garden is private and not overlooked, offering a peaceful and secluded outdoor space ideal for relaxing or entertaining.

Situated within a quiet cul-de-sac in the sought-after Haughton Grange area of Darlington, this property is ideally positioned for easy access to a range of local amenities, including shops, restaurants, schools and leisure facilities. With excellent transport links, the A66 and A1(M) are just a few minutes’ drive away, while local bus services are also within walking distance, making this an ideal location for commuters.
